Onboarding note for the Ledgerpane admin table: bulk edits are applied through the batcher service, not directly against the database. Select rows, choose an action, and the batcher stages changes in a pending set you can review before commit. Edits over 500 rows require a second approver — this is enforced server-side, so don't try to chunk around it. To run the batcher locally you need the staging write credential, which goes in your .env as the next line.

secret setting of bahip-kagag: RELAY_SECRET3=c83

**Onboarding: Emberline Loyalty Ledger — On-call notes**

The loyalty-points ledger at Emberline records every accrual and redemption as an append-only event. If the ledger writer stalls, points appear frozen but no data is lost; events buffer in the Dunmoor queue for up to six hours. Your first action should always be checking consumer lag, never replaying manually. If a full restore is required, unlock the restore tooling with the recovery passphrase listed below.

strongbox words: raleth-ralvan-aldiel-ulaax-istix-zorok-kelax-kelox-wenix-zormir-aldix-silael-normir

## Changelog — RateMirror 3.2.0

Defaults changed. Heads up if you're onboarding: the parity checker for the Ardenhaus hotel group now scans every 2 hours instead of 6, and price-delta tolerance dropped from 3% to 1.5%. Channel comparisons now exclude opaque packages by default. Old configs still load but log deprecation warnings; migrate before the next minor release. Mismatch alerts route to the revenue queue, not ops. The new default configuration is as follows.

deployment values, kajep-kageg:
[praix]
host = praix.paliqcorp.corp
user = praix_svc
database = praix_prod

**Q: Why does Pondwright keep exhausting database connections during deploys?**

A: The pool in Pondwright defaults to 40 connections per instance, and rolling deploys briefly double the instance count. Old pods hold connections until their drain timeout expires, so the database hits its cap. Either lower the per-instance pool size or raise the drain aggressiveness in the deploy config. Do not raise the database limit without checking replica headroom. If you're unsure which knob to turn, ask the data platform crew here.

escalation mailbox, bafog-fafog: ulador@paliqlabs.internal